- Munich's Sophie Schnell journeys through the space between life and death across eleven tracks.
Sophie Schnell, AKA PYUR, is releasing her second LP on Subtext Recordings.
On Oratorio For The Underworld, the German artist channels her experience growing up in a shamanic family, exploring the liminal state between life and death by fusing modern sound design with strings and voice. Written over the course of two years and comprising 11 tracks, the LP also features the cello of Teresa Alvarez and Juan Zalba Fuentes' violin.
Oratorio For The Underworld will be available on digital and CD from October 10th. It arrives three years after the artist's debut effort for Hotflush, Epoch Sinus.
